An electric golf cart battery charger represents a sophisticated charging solution specifically engineered to maintain and replenish the power systems of electric golf vehicles. This essential equipment serves as the primary interface between standard electrical outlets and golf cart battery banks, converting alternating current from wall outlets into the direct current required by cart batteries. The electric golf cart battery charger incorporates advanced microprocessor technology that monitors charging cycles, prevents overcharging, and extends battery lifespan through intelligent power management. Modern chargers feature automatic voltage detection capabilities, allowing them to work seamlessly with various battery configurations including 24-volt, 36-volt, and 48-volt systems commonly found in contemporary golf carts. The charging process begins when the unit connects to both the electrical supply and the cart's charging port, initiating a multi-stage charging sequence that includes bulk charging, absorption, and float maintenance phases. Temperature compensation technology ensures optimal charging performance across different environmental conditions, while built-in safety mechanisms protect against short circuits, reverse polarity, and thermal overload. The electric golf cart battery charger typically houses LED indicator systems that provide real-time status updates, displaying charging progress, completion notifications, and any error conditions that may arise during operation.
